Managed Dedicated Server Packages

QuickPacket offers managed dedicated servers to our clients. Basic management is included with most dedicated servers. Basic management includes the services listed below with a one hour limit per month and a 15 minute minimum per request. Server management is currently only available on select Linux-based systems with cPanel, DirectAdmin, or InterWorx. The following services are included with our basic level of management. Additional services are available through our Managed Support Services.

1. Server Configuration - Our technicians will help you initially configure your server and will answer any questions you might have about the functionality of the control panel.

2. Server Troubleshooting - If your server is having performance issues, we will help you find the cause and make suggestions based on our observations.

3. Control Panel Support - If you purchase a control panel from us, we will answer any questions or problems you may have related to the function of the control panel.

4. Operating System Patch and Security Updates - We will update your server using yum, apt, or a similar service.

5. Optional Services - The following services can be requested for no charge by submitting a support ticket.

- We will disable unnecessary services running with by default.
- We will secure your /tmp, /var/tmp, and /dev/shm directories.
- We will install mod_security and configure it with our default rule set.
- We will install a firewall (CSF/LFD - cPanel; APF/BFD - cPanel/DirectAdmin/InterWorx)
- We will configure LogWatch to send a daily e-mail report.
- We will install GD, FreeType, mcrypt, ImageMagick, curl, Zend, and ionCube.
- We will disable unnecessary cPanel/WHM services and options.
- We will disable SSHv1, configure a unique SSHv2 port, and disable direct root login.
- We will setup an alert e-mail whenever a user logs in as root.
- We will setup rkhunter and/or chkrootkit and configure it send you a report once per day.
- We will modify wget/GET/lynx/curl so that they can only be run by the root user.
